Definitions from Wiktionary (cratch)
▸ verb: (obsolete) To scratch.
▸ noun: (obsolete) A grated crib or manger.
▸ noun: (nautical) The vertical planks at the forward end of the hold of a traditional English narrowboat which constrain the cargo and support the top plank or walkway.
▸ noun: A swelling on a horse's pastern, under the fetlock.
